Mike Myers (from the Austin Powers trilogy) stars in this comedy as Guru Pitka, a self-help spiritual guide along the lines of a Deepak Chopra caricature. The Toronto hockey team owner (Jessica Alba) hires Guru Pitka when her best player's wife gets into an affair with LA Kings goalie Jacques "Le Coq" Grande (Justin Timberlake). The Toronto team is led by Coach Cherkov (Verne Troyer, who played Mini-Me in Austin Powers films). The movie contains flashbacks to Pitka's youth when he trained at an Indian ashram under Guru Tugginmypudha (Ben Kingsley).
